A Saturday morning, at the most busy city centre, thousands of people in coats of red, blue, and green (which represent the different workers' trade unions) marched onto the street and through the drizzle to protest against the company...

Reason: Volkswagen decides to close down its plant in Belgium and shift it back to Germany. More than 4000 jobs will be lost, including those suppliers which may be affected as well. People say that it may be because of nationalism...
